
Dance Nation

Co-Produced with State Theatre Company of South AustraliaSomewhere in America, away from the bright lights, a group of young teen girls prepare for the most important event of their lives – a dance show contest.
But all the anxieties and confusions of the adult world come sashaying on stage, revealing a dog-eat-dog drama. The girls are played by adult women, as if they’re reliving past agonies and triumphs.
This is a comic play of memory and feminist power, and a subtly subversive exploration of the time of life when the demons get in.
